有个表比如
|name | account | value|
|1 |1212 |2222|
|2 | 2222 |232323|
|3 | 1212 |3333|
然后我要出个报表
第一行 account_no 是 1212 的 数字和
第二行 account_no 是 1212 或者 2222 的 数字和
第三行 account_no 是 第一行第二行 之和
是不是只能一行行 select 出来然后 union 或者全 select 出来行转列? 有没有简便的写法,几百行的报表。。。
1
rocksolid OP 都没什么办法么 T_T
|
2
tomczhen 2017-10-20 20:42:59 +08:00
SQL 语句的问题通常提问的人如果能有逻辑的描述要得到什么数据,那么语句其实也出来了。
|